Taylor Swift unveiled her star-studded music video for "Opalite" on Friday, leaning into surreal storytelling and a sweeping roster of celebrity cameos as she continues the rollout of her latest chart-topping album.
The pop superstar premiered the visual on Spotify and Apple Music on Feb. 6, marking the second music video from her 2025 release The Life of a Showgirl.
The clip blends absurdist humor and nostalgic visuals, opening with a mock commercial for a fictional "Opalite" spray designed to turn "crappiness into happiness."
The narrative follows Swift forming an emotional bond with a gray rock pulled from a "best friend box," taking it on dates and crafting a friendship bracelet before meeting actor Domhnall Gleeson, whose own attachment to a cactus leads to a romantic arc.
Their story culminates in a choreographed dance sequence onstage in matching blue sequined jumpsuits, while the rock and cactus are later displayed together in a shopping mall scene.
Swift's star-studded cast in new video
Swift said the concept stemmed from an idea sparked during an October 2025 appearance on The Graham Norton Show, where Gleeson jokingly suggested appearing in one of her videos.
The remark inspired Travis Kelce's girlfriend to invite fellow guests and collaborators to participate, turning the project into what she described as a collaborative creative experiment.
Additional cameos include Greta Lee as a TV singer, Jodie Turner-Smith leading an aerobics class, Lewis Capaldi as a photographer, Graham Norton portraying a salesman for the fictional spray.
Oscar-winner Cillian Murphy featured on a billboard advertisement. Eras Tour dancer Kameron Saunders appears as a judge scoring Swift and Gleeson's performance.
Swift teased the release earlier in the week via her website with a countdown clock and confirmed the video will reach YouTube audiences on Feb. 8, a delayed platform debut that follows YouTube's removal of streaming data from Billboard chart calculations announced in December.
Swift is breaking records with her new album
"Opalite" follows the video for lead single "The Fate of Ophelia" as Swift extends promotion of The Life of a Showgirl, which sold 4 million units in its first week and became her 15th No. 1 album on the Billboard 200 - giving her the record for most chart-topping albums among solo artists.
All tracks from the album also entered the Billboard Hot 100 during release week, occupying the top 12 positions.
